Monetary policy is conducted by the Bank of Canada, which is a government-owned Crown corporation that operates with considerable independence from the federal government but it nonetheless ultimately accountable to Parliament.

Because financial capital can move easily within Canada, interest rates on similar assets are the same across all Canadian regions. As a result, there is only one monetary policy for all of Canada. The Bank of Canada is the sole issuer of legal tender (bank notes) in Canada.

Although several economic variables influence monetary policy decisions, the Bank of Canada has only one policy instrument.
